Getting to Know the NYC Cruise Terminal
A West Side Port With a Long Ocean Story
The NYC Cruise Terminal, listed on maps as the New York City Passenger Ship Terminal, has anchored the Hudson shoreline since the 1930s, on the same finger piers where the grand transatlantic liners of the last century once berthed. Ship manifests and photographs from that golden era of ocean travel sit among the collections of the National Archives, a record of the millions who passed through these gates. Today the port ranks among the leading cruise gateways in North America, launching voyages from the center of Manhattan.

Terminal Rundown and Contact Details
The NYC Cruise Terminal runs along the Hudson on the West Side of Midtown, and these are the details guests need before arrival:
- Address: 711 12th Ave, New York, NY 10019, United States
- Piers: 88, 90, and 92, spanning West 46th to West 54th Streets
- Phone: +1 212 641 4440
- Official website:cruise.nyc
- Cruise lines: Norwegian, MSC, Carnival, Oceania, and Regent among the regular callers
How Busy the Piers Get
The port moves several hundred thousand travelers a year, and the crush peaks on turnaround days when a returning ship empties as the next one loads. The stretch from late spring into autumn stays the busiest, and weekend departures pack the Twelfth Avenue lanes soon after sunrise, so timing the arrival matters.
Parking at the Terminal
A multilevel garage rises above the piers, charging by the day with a fixed number of spaces that sell out early on sailing mornings. Extended parking exists for guests who drive in, though the running cost across a week at sea, plus the walk back to the car, sends many travelers toward a chauffeur instead.
Curbside Handling for Pickup and Drop Off
Drop off runs along Twelfth Avenue in front of the terminal, where porters take luggage a few steps from the check in hall. When more than one vessel departs the same morning the lanes squeeze tight, so an early slot and a driver who understands the approach keep the exchange quick and calm.

Tips for Arriving Passengers
Keep your passport, boarding pass, and luggage tags together and reach the port inside your assigned check in window. Attach your bag tags before the curb, hold medications and valuables on your person, and pad the schedule for the West Side traffic that builds near the Lincoln Tunnel approaches.
